(17の回答)
3年前に閉鎖されました。
HTML5に関する本からいくつかの演習を完了しているときに、Webアプリケーションをテストドライブするためのサーバーのインストールに関する章に到達しました。問題は、この本は、Linuxディストリビューションのすべてのユーザーが、自分のマシンにサーバーをセットアップする方法と方法を知っていることを前提としていることです。著者はまた、LinuxディストリビューションにはデフォルトでApacheがインストールされている可能性があると主張しています。
これはUbuntu16.04の場合ですか?もしそうなら、どうすればWebアプリを試乗するためにアクセスできますか?そうでない場合、どのような選択肢がありますか?
承認された回答:
物事をシンプルに保つことをお勧めします。 Apache2をインストールできます。 MySQL; PHPと必要なすべての依存関係を1つのコマンドで実行できます。
インストール
端末から次のように入力します:
sudo apt install lamp-server^
sudo
がある場合 権利を取得すると、パスワードの入力を求められます。パスワードを入力すると、aptは必要な依存関係のリストをまとめます。
次に、これらのパッケージのインストールを確認するかどうかを尋ねられます。
Yを押します 、次に Enter キー
パッケージのインストール中に、画面が次のように変化します。
新しいroot
を入力してください MySQLのパスワード。これは、データベースとユーザー権限を調整するために使用するMySQL管理者パスワードです。
もう一度プロンプトが表示されます:
新しいrootパスワードをもう一度入力し、 Enterを押します。
完了
これにより、Apache2がインストールされて起動します。 MySQLとPHP7。
Webサイトのルートディレクトリは次のようになります:
/var/www/html
このディレクトリにファイルを置くことができ、Webアドレスは次のようになります:
http://<ip address of server>/
メモ
すでにindex.html
があることを忘れないでください /var/www/html
内 おそらく交換または削除する必要があります。